A Letter to Ben Bernanke

N. Gregory Mankiw ()

No 2110, Harvard Institute of Economic Research Working Papers from Harvard - Institute of Economic Research

Abstract: This paper discusses five questions the incoming chairman of the Federal Reserve must ponder as he assumes his new post. How important are monetary rules? Should the Fed adopt inflation targeting? Should he be free with his opinions? Should he be a high-profile public figure? Is it more important to be good or lucky?
